In a current era where stats are for the most part sread so thin, I don't believe invested stats being mandatory to obtain traits such as Daily Prayer or Bad Egg is fair. Builds who in the first place would've been fine investing in the stat eat good, while the rest is basically stripped of a class point unless they bother to invest in the stat, which sometimes outright cannot be afforded.
Class points and Stat points both being the few remaining resources that feel 'tight' as it is, so the trade-off of going out of your way for an extra point is usually not worth the cost.
Not every MA will be investing in CEL (examples like tankier variants of Monk or Boxer) , not every rogue will have some GUI (VAs who mostly want the class for Impure memes, or STs that don't particularly benefit from the stat at all) , an Aquamancer won't always bother to build FAI, and I'm sure there are many, many other examples that could be pointed out here.
Could those traits just be available with enough levels of the class instead ? LV 20-30 sounds like a good idea to me. Or require the actual stat rather than the base one.

(02-24-2023, 07:56 PM)Lolzytripd Wrote: Every class that wants the extra points has to build the stat specific to their class, that's not build diversity, thats build homogeny.
Full agree on this point.
If, say, an MA wants that extra skill point they are forced to put points into CEL, even if they otherwise aren't using CEL. You are being incentivized to build a particular way, getting more for building the way the game wants you to and receiving less for going against the grain. For this to promote diversity, the two options would have to be equivalent on some level and they are not.

If not every Aquamancer builds FAI, then the ones who do have a small advantage in the form of an extra skill point compared to the ones who don't.
How is this homogenizing compared to the alternative where every single Aquamancer takes the trait?
